Origin and History of Semper Fi

Origin and History of Semper Fi

The phrase Semper Fi is an abbreviation of the Latin words Semper Fidelis, meaning “Always Faithful.”

The United States Marine Corps officially adopted Semper Fidelis as its motto in 1883. Since then, it has become a defining part of Marine Corps identity, representing loyalty to the nation, fellow Marines, and the Corps itself.

Today, the phrase is recognized worldwide as a symbol of honor, service, and dedication.

Semper Fi vs Oorah Difference

These military expressions have different purposes.

Semper Fi

Represents loyalty, honor, faithfulness, and commitment.

Oorah

A motivational battle cry used by U.S. Marines to express enthusiasm, confidence, or determination.

Example:

“The Marines shouted ‘Oorah!’ after completing the exercise.”

Simple difference:

Semper Fi = Motto meaning “Always Faithful.”

Oorah = Motivational expression.
